iDod Fact Sheet on Aurora’s Immigrant Community Featured in El Comercio de Colorado

The Institute for Immigration Research’s (IIR) Immigration Data on Demand (iDod) fact sheet created for the City of Aurora, Colorado, was recently featured in El Comercio de Colorado in an article highlighting how immigrant communities contribute to Aurora’s growth, diversity, and economic vitality.

The iDod fact sheet provides comprehensive data on Aurora’s foreign-born population, including demographic, economic, educational, employment, health, and housing characteristics. Developed in collaboration with the City of Aurora and community partners, the report highlights the diverse backgrounds and significant contributions of immigrants and refugees who call Aurora home.

This feature underscores the importance of accessible, data-driven research in helping communities better understand their populations and develop informed policies that support inclusion, opportunity, and belonging.
